Order No. 10, 139 Offer to Frank P. Cullum, Sr. , and Wife, Edith Y. Cullum, for Right-of-Way for F, M. Road 1340 On this the 13th day of December, 1965 came on to be heard and con- sidered by the Court the matter of compensation to be paid Frank P. Cullum, Sr, , and wife, Edith Y. Cullum, for their conveyance to the State of Texas of 13, 149 acres of land and granting of one channel easement comprising 0. 245 acres, which land and easement axe required for the construction and reloca- tion of F. M. Road 1340; and after due consideration by the Court, it is ordered on motion by Commissioner Stone seconded by Commissioner Mosty and unanimously approved by the Court that Kerr County hereby offers to pay Frank P. Cullum, Sr. , and wife, Edith Y. Cullum, the sum of $1, 325.00 compensation for land and damages as consideration for their conveyance to the State of Texas of 13, 149 acres of land out of Surveys 1354 and 1655 and for their granting of one channel easement comprising 0. 245 acres oat of Survey 1354 and in addition to the foregoing cash consideration, Kerr County will, prior to commencement of construction of the new roadway, construct on both sides of the right-of-way granted, a deer-proof fence consisting of cedar posts set 30 feet apart with three 7 1 j2 foot 3 j8" diam- eter corrugated steel stays between each post, with the wire consisting of two courses of 939-12-12 1 J2 net wire topped with nne smooth cable wire and, in aanjiuiction with said fencing, Kerr County will relocate the existing entrance gate at Bee Cave Greek and provide two additional entrance gates of equivalent quality on opposite sides of the roadway in the proximity of Station 28 of the centerline as well as two entrance gates on opposite sides of the roadway between station 20and 20150 of the centerline and all existing fencing on the right-of-way conveyed will be by Kerr County with salvaged materials being left for use by the property owners; and further Kerr County will case and if necessary relocate the existing water line crossing the roadway at Bee Cave Creek; and provided further that in addi- tion to the other consideration herein offered, Kerr County will, after construction of the new roadway, request the Texas Highway Department to close and abandon as a public roadway that portion of the existing route of F, M. Road 1340 begin- ning at the present Mo-Ranch entrance and running east to the point of intersection with the new roadway at Bee Cave Greek and, upon such closing, request the State of Texas to quitclaim the said abandoned right-of-way to Kerr County and Kerr County will then in turn quitclaim to Frank P, Cullum, Sr. , that portion of said abandoned right-of-way which he originally conveyed to the State of Texas at no cost to Kerr County; and further upon the closing and abandonment of said old roadway, Kerr County will remove the existing right-of-way fencing along the north side of said roadway with salvaged materials being left for use of the pro- perty owners and will relocate the existing entrance on the north side of tlxe present light-of-~ay at a point across the end of the abandoned rigi7t-of-way and Kerr Count}l' will lso close the resulting gap in the existing river bank fencing which will r~s~xlt at the east end of the existing Mo-Ranch bridge. Kerr County combination and jeep road will also, upo~ request, clear a/livestock passage way/up the south bank of Bee Cave Creek at, the nearest point to the south right-of-way line of the new roadway where,-the terl!ain will permit an ordinary bulldozer to feasibly accomplish such clearing ahd will, upon request, extend such clearing along the top of the Bee Cave Greek bluff to the new right-of-way line, and construct a drift fence of standard height approximately 80 yards in length from the new right-of-way line on the north end of the Bee Cave Creek bluff and running south to where the top of the bluff becomes perpendicular and in addition Kerr County will modify the fencing and gates of the present livestock holding pens at Bee Gave Creek so as to provide adequate access for trailer trucks from the relocated entrance gate to the loading chute pens and in conjunction herewith furnish an additional pen gate and make all necessary adjustments in road and fencing alignments, And it is further ordered that the Clerk and the Treasurer be authorized in the amount of $132}. 00 to draw avoucher/on the F, M, 1340 Right-of-Way Fund payable to Frank P. Cullum, Sr, , and Edith Y.
